Job description

HRIS Administration:

· Manage the HRIS system, including configuration, updates, and maintenance.

· Perform regular audits of HRIS data to ensure accuracy and integrity.

· Serve as the primary point of contact for HRIS-related inquiries and troubleshooting.

· Collaborate with IT and vendors to resolve technical issues related to the HRIS.

· Train and support HR staff and end-users on HRIS functionalities and best practices.

· Maintain detailed documentation of payroll, commission and HR processes

Payroll Management:

· Process bi-weekly payroll ensuring compliance with federal, state, and local regulations.

· Collect, calculate, and input payroll data such as employee hours, deductions, and bonuses into the HRIS.

· Review payroll reports for discrepancies and take corrective actions as necessary.

· Maintain accurate records of payroll transactions and employee information.

· Maintain the General Ledger for payroll in ADP

· Assist in year-end tax reporting, including W-2 and 1095 preparation for ACA reporting.

Reporting and Compliance:

· Generate and analyze HRIS and payroll reports for management to support decision-making.

· Monitor compliance with labor laws, tax regulations, and company policies related to payroll and employee data.

· Conduct regular reviews of HRIS processes and payroll systems to identify areas for improvement.

· Work closely with HR team members on various projects related to employee data management and payroll improvements.

· Assist with onboarding and offboarding processes, ensuring proper document management within the HRIS.

· Support benefits administration, including billing, audits, tracking eligibility and enrollment.

· Compliance reporting support and Audits

Sales Commission:

· Provide support to Manager as needed for monthly commission calculations.
